技术人的沟通公式:如何把复杂问题讲简单?
在软件测试领域沟通不仅是传递信息的工具更是保障项目成功的关键桥梁。测试从业者常面临一个核心挑战如何向非技术背景的同事如产品经理、客户或管理层解释复杂的缺陷、技术限制或测试策略晦涩的专业术语和冗长的逻辑链条往往导致误解、延误决策甚至引发不必要的冲突。本文针对软件测试从业者从专业角度拆解一套实用沟通公式——技术参数 × 业务场景 决策价值帮助您将复杂问题化繁为简提升团队协作效率与职业影响力。一、为什么软件测试者需要沟通公式软件测试工作涉及多维度协作从缺陷报告到测试方案评审从自动化脚本说明到风险评估沟通。测试工程师常陷入“技术深坑”——专注于精确描述代码逻辑或测试用例细节却忽略受众的真实需求。非技术人员关心的是业务影响而非技术过程。例如开发人员可能纠结于“Selenium脚本的并发执行失败率”但产品经理只想知道“用户支付功能是否稳定”。客户听到“内存泄漏导致API超时”时会误以为系统崩溃而实际影响可能是“订单提交延迟3秒”。沟通失败的直接后果包括需求偏差、项目延期或线上故障。研究显示IT项目中70%的问题源于信息传递失误。因此测试从业者必须掌握简化沟通的艺术这不仅提升个人专业形象还直接推动项目质量与团队信任。二、核心公式拆解技术参数 × 业务场景 决策价值本公式源自跨领域沟通的最佳实践强调将抽象技术转化为可行动的洞察。公式的每个元素需精准匹配软件测试场景1.技术参数剥离冗余聚焦核心事实技术参数是沟通的起点但必须过滤非必要细节。测试从业者应量化关键指标避免模糊描述如“性能较差”。改用“并发用户100时响应时间从1秒增至5秒超出SLA阈值。”简化术语用生活化语言替代行话。例如原句“发现一个NullPointerException因异步回调失败。”简化“系统在处理用户请求时卡死因后台未及时记录操作。”优先级排序仅传递影响决策的参数。缺陷报告时优先说明“必现率”和“影响模块”而非所有日志细节。2.业务场景锚定用户价值与风险业务场景是“翻译”技术的核心需将测试问题映射到实际工作流。关键策略包括用户故事框架用叙事结构解释技术问题。例如问题“回归测试覆盖率不足导致线上缺陷。”场景化“想象用户在新版本点击‘支付’按钮时失败——因旧功能未全面验证类似去年电商大促的订单丢失事件直接影响营收。”风险量化将技术问题转化为业务损失。如“此缺陷在负载测试中出现率90%若不修复可能导致双十一期间20%订单失败。”角色适配针对不同受众调整场景对管理层强调成本与时间如“修复需2人天延后上线风险降低30%”。对客户聚焦体验如“优化后用户登录成功率从85%提升至99%”。3.决策价值驱动行动与共识决策价值是公式的产出需明确“下一步做什么”。测试沟通的目标是促成共识而非展示技术深度提供可选项将技术方案转化为商业选择。例如选项A“立即修复缺陷需2天开发资源确保功能稳定。”选项B“临时关闭问题模块按计划上线下周热更新修复。”可视化支撑用图表简化复杂数据。例如缺陷分布热力图高亮高频故障模块。测试进度燃尽图展示用例执行率与风险点。明确建议结尾强调行动呼吁如“建议本迭代优先修复高优先级缺陷避免用户流失”。三、实用技巧软件测试者的沟通工具箱公式需搭配具体技巧才能在测试日常中落地。以下是针对从业者的高效方法1.类比与比喻跨越认知鸿沟类比是测试沟通的“超级武器”能将抽象概念具象化数据库索引 ≈ 图书目录解释索引优化时说“没有索引就像从书库第一页找一句话有索引后直接翻到目录页查询效率翻倍。”自动化测试 ≈ 汽车质检流水线描述回归测试重要性时比喻“每次代码更新后自动化脚本像质检员检查螺丝是否拧紧防止‘高速行驶时轮胎脱落’的系统崩溃。”缓存机制 ≈ 办公桌文件架说明性能优化“缓存是把常用数据从数据库文件柜放到内存桌面架下次访问快如闪电。”2.结构化表达逻辑链条清晰化复杂问题需分步拆解避免信息过载三步框架所有沟通按“现象→原因→方案”组织现象“搜索功能在安卓12设备上元素错位率100%。”原因“兼容性库未适配新系统分辨率。”方案“更新库版本预估耗时4小时。”流程图辅助用简易图表展示测试逻辑。例如登录功能测试路径graph LR A[用户输入] -- B{认证检查} B --|成功| C[进入主页] B --|失败| D[提示错误]3.场景化演练测试案例实战软件测试特有的场景中公式的应用示例如下案例1向产品经理解释全流程测试必要性错误方式“底层接口变更需回归测试。”公式化表达“这次改动像动房屋承重梁技术参数。我们必须检查所有‘水电管线’业务流程否则支付功能可能‘漏水’业务风险。全流程测试需8小时但能避免用户订单失败决策价值。”案例2报告偶现缺陷模糊描述“发现概率性NullPointerException。”简化升级“系统在高峰期偶发‘卡顿’现象如高速公路神秘颠簸。通过日志监控参数我们建议增加检测点方案以防大促时用户流失价值。”四、提升路径从技术专家到沟通高手掌握公式需持续练习与迭代自我训练每日选一个测试问题如缺陷报告尝试用“参数×场景价值”框架重写。录制讲解视频观察是否能让外行理解。团队协作在需求评审会上主动提问“您最关心的业务目标是什么”以此定制沟通。建立团队术语表如统一“阻塞问题”定义减少歧义。工具赋能用Confluence构建动态文档库关联测试用例、缺陷记录与业务需求。仪表盘工具如Grafana实时展示测试数据支持决策沟通。结语沟通是测试者的核心竞争力在软件测试领域技术能力是基础但沟通能力决定职业高度。通过“技术参数 × 业务场景 决策价值”的公式您能将复杂的测试问题转化为简洁、可行动的洞察赢得团队信任并推动质量提升。记住优秀测试工程师不仅是缺陷发现者更是问题的“翻译官”与解决方案的推动者。从今天起用这套公式重塑您的沟通方式让每一次对话都成为项目成功的催化剂。